本文整理汇总了PHP中Commande::get_result方法的典型用法代码示例。如果您正苦于以下问题:PHP Commande::get_result方法的具体用法?PHP Commande::get_result怎么用?PHP Commande::get_result使用的例子?那么恭喜您,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在类Commande
的用法示例。
在下文中一共展示了Commande::get_result方法的3个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的PHP代码示例。
示例1: getList
public function getList($order, $critere, $debut, $nbres)
{
$query = $this->getRequest('list', $order, $critere, $debut, $nbres);
$resul = $this->query($query);
$retour = array();
while ($resul && ($row = $this->fetch_object($resul))) {
$thisClient = array();
$thisClient['ref'] = $row->ref;
$thisClient['entreprise'] = $row->entreprise;
$thisClient['nom'] = $row->nom;
$thisClient['prenom'] = $row->prenom;
$thisClient['email'] = $row->email;
$commande = new Commande();
$devise = new Devise();
$querycom = "SELECT id FROM {$commande->table} WHERE client={$row->id} AND statut NOT IN(" . Commande::NONPAYE . "," . Commande::ANNULE . ") ORDER BY date DESC LIMIT 0,1";
$resulcom = $commande->query($querycom);
if ($commande->num_rows($resulcom) > 0) {
$idcom = $commande->get_result($resulcom, 0, "id");
$commande->charger($idcom);
$devise->charger($commande->devise);
$thisClient['date'] = strftime("%d/%m/%Y %H:%M:%S", strtotime($commande->date));
$thisClient['somme'] = formatter_somme($commande->total(true, true)) . ' ' . $devise->symbole;
} else {
$thisClient['date'] = '';
$thisClient['somme'] = '';
}
$retour[] = $thisClient;
}
return $retour;
}
示例2: liste_clients
function liste_clients($order, $critere, $debut)
{
$i = 0;
$client = new Client();
$query = "select * from {$client->table} order by {$critere} {$order} limit {$debut},20";
$resul = $client->query($query);
while ($resul && ($row = $client->fetch_object($resul))) {
$fond = "ligne_" . ($i++ % 2 ? "claire" : "fonce") . "_rub";
$commande = new Commande();
$devise = new Devise();
$querycom = "select id from {$commande->table} where client={$row->id} and statut not in(" . Commande::NONPAYE . "," . Commande::ANNULE . ") order by date DESC limit 0,1";
$resulcom = $commande->query($querycom);
$existe = 0;
if ($commande->num_rows($resulcom) > 0) {
$existe = 1;
$idcom = $commande->get_result($resulcom, 0, "id");
$commande->charger($idcom);
$devise->charger($commande->devise);
$date = strftime("%d/%m/%y %H:%M:%S", strtotime($commande->date));
}
$creation = strftime("%d/%m/%y %H:%M:%S", strtotime($row->datecrea));
?>
<ul class="<?php
echo $fond;
?>
">
<li style="width:122px;"><?php
echo $row->ref;
?>
</li>
<li style="width:110px;"><?php
echo $creation;
?>
</li>
<li style="width:143px;"><?php
echo $row->entreprise;
?>
</li>
<li style="width:243px;"><?php
echo $row->nom;
?>
<?php
echo $row->prenom;
?>
</li>
<li style="width:110px;"><?php
if ($existe) {
echo $date;
}
?>
</li>
<li style="width:63px;"><?php
if ($existe) {
echo formatter_somme($commande->total(true, true)) . ' ' . $devise->symbole;
}
?>
</li>
<li style="width:40px;"><a href="client_visualiser.php?ref=<?php
echo $row->ref;
?>
" class="txt_vert_11"><?php
echo trad('editer', 'admin');
?>
</a></li>
<li style="width:25px; text-align:center;"><a href="#" onclick="confirmSupp('<?php
echo $row->ref;
?>
')"><img src="gfx/supprimer.gif" width="9" height="9" border="0" /></a></li>
</ul>
<?php
}
}
示例3: IN
$search = "";
} else {
if ($_GET['statut'] != "") {
$search = "and statut IN(" . $_GET['statut'] . ")";
}
}
if ($client != "") {
$search .= " and client=\"{$client}\"";
}
$commande = new Commande();
if ($page == "") {
$page = 1;
}
$query = "select count(*) from {$commande->table} where 1 {$search}";
$resul = $commande->query($query);
$num = $resul ? $commande->get_result($resul, 0) : 0;
$nbpage = 20;
$nbres = 30;
$totnbpage = ceil($num / $nbres);
$debut = ($page - 1) * $nbres;
if ($page > 1) {
$pageprec = $page - 1;
} else {
$pageprec = $page;
}
if ($page < $totnbpage) {
$pagesuiv = $page + 1;
} else {
$pagesuiv = $page;
}
if ($classement == "client") {